Top SCRYPTmail Alternative Email Services for Enhanced Privacy
SCRYPTmail has carved out a niche as a true end-to-end encrypted email service, known for encrypting both email content and metadata like sender/recipient information. With its public source code, zero-data knowledge approach, and features like disposable emails and strong RSA key support, it prioritizes user privacy. However, like any software, users might seek a SCRYPTmail alternative for various reasons, whether it's looking for different feature sets, specific platform availability, or simply exploring other highly secure options in the market.

Posteo
Posteo is a commercial, web- and IMAP-based email service based in Germany, costing 1€/month for 2GB of storage. Information is hosted on encrypted hard drives, and they use electricity from renewable resources. While not open-source, it offers calendar integration, encrypted email, and a focus on privacy and transparency, making it a reliable SCRYPTmail alternative for those seeking a paid, eco-friendly option.

Enigmail
Enigmail is a security extension for Mozilla Thunderbird and SeaMonkey. It's Free and Open Source, compatible with Mac, Windows, and Linux, and integrates GnuPG for encrypted email. While not a standalone email service like SCRYPTmail, it's an essential SCRYPTmail alternative for users who prefer using Thunderbird or SeaMonkey and want to add robust encryption capabilities to their existing setup.

Mailvelope
Mailvelope is a Free and Open Source browser extension for Mac, Windows, Linux, Chrome OS, Microsoft Edge, Chrome, and Firefox. It allows for encrypted email exchange following the OpenPGP standard, integrating directly into webmail services. Similar to Enigmail, Mailvelope is an excellent SCRYPTmail alternative for users who want to add encryption to their existing webmail interface without switching services.
